Design / Illustration - Advanced

Tutor: Iain Watt

Studio: Design G1.09

Class day(s): Monday

Maximum number of students: 15


Description
The Design / Illustration - Advanced class is for students who have completed one or more of the Tuesday and Wednesday classes and are specialising in the subject.
I offer more detailed technical and conceptual assistance in individual seminars. If beginners / intermediates cannot timetable Tuesday or Wednesday you're welcome to come on the Monday.

Content:
* To provide concentrated one on one tutorial sessions
* Assistance with preparing business cards, portfolio formats, CV presentation and websites
* Briefs include but are not limited to - visual possibilities of metaphor, book jacket illustration, illustration for newspaper or magazine

Objectives:
* To further develop and refine your visual communication skills through intensive tutoring and seminar sessions
* To assist you to focus on your area of specialisation, with the aim of gaining professional experience

Outcomes:
* A deeper understanding of illustrative / design processes and practice
* Introduction to the requirements of the workplace with, wherever possible, practical work experience
